The cost of uPVC windows is contingent on the style and type you choose. For example, you can choose fully opening casement windows that are side-hung and open outwards tilt and turn windows, that open in a variety of directions (great for ventilation) or bay and bow windows that make a curved projection out of your home. You can also get various window handles and furniture that fit your interior style, which will add to the overall appearance.

Certain uPVC windows are available in a variety of colors to match your house, however the most sought-after color is white. However, it might not work for your house especially if you live in a cottage so it's important to find a colour that complements the rest of your home.
